SCREEN YOURSELF TODAY FOR EVERY COMMON DISORDER AND POST THE RESULTS ON THE SUB!!

Q1. what is screening? why should I bother?

→ It indicates whether your symptoms may be worth discussing with a licenced professional, that's why you should screen yourself

Q2. I got high scores on some tests, now what to do?

→ go and consult a licenced profesional and show them the high scores, do not self-diagnose! A high score means this is worth checking' not 'you have this condition'. A low score does not completely rule anything out

LAZY VERSION:

ADHD → ASRS

Autism → RAADS-R

Anxiety → GAD-7

Depression → PHQ-9

FULL VERSION:

THE 5 SECOND RULE IS OP!

TLDR: The moment you think of doing something… you count 5-4-3-2-1 and STAND IMMEDIATELY

that's it, once you stand up, you will automatically do the task you are supposed to do :)

why this works: It interrupts task paralysis, bypasses your brain’s favorite hobby: procrastination rationalization, It forces action before emotion catches up
